M-Kube - Atmosphere Furnace

A laboratory atmosphere furnace is a specialized tool designed for precise thermal processing under controlled atmospheres, making it indispensable for high-quality material synthesis and analytical applications. This furnace allows users to create and maintain specific atmospheric conditions—such as inert, reducing, or oxidizing environments—within the chamber, which is crucial for processes like sintering, annealing, and thermal treatments of sensitive materials. With advanced temperature control and the ability to regulate various gas flows, the laboratory atmosphere furnace ensures consistent and reproducible results. Its robust design and safety features make it an essential instrument for research and development in materials science, chemistry, and other scientific disciplines where atmospheric conditions are critical.

M-Kube - Convection oven

Our convection ovens are specifically designed for general drying, heating, and thermal applications where a gentle airflow is required. These ovens rely on natural air circulation, providing even heat distribution without the need for a fan. This makes them ideal for processes involving sensitive samples, as the absence of forced airflow minimizes the risk of sample disturbance, contamination, or dehydration.

M-Kube - Vacuum Oven

Our Vacuum Ovens are specifically engineered to meet the demands of delicate and temperature-sensitive processes. By operating in a low-pressure environment, these ovens offer precise control over temperature and pressure, allowing for gentle drying, heat treatment, and degassing without the risk of oxidation or contamination. This makes them the ideal choice for handling sensitive samples that may degrade under normal atmospheric conditions.
